Fennelgate audit-log viewer: restart order is ingester, indexer, UI. Check lag on the events queue before declaring healthy. If the viewer shows gaps, replay from the last checkpoint — takes ~10 min. Escalate only if replay fails twice. Manual replay calls hit the internal replay service and require the key below.

gateway credential: kto3_qfe

Q: How do I get into the temporary site at Harrowfield Yard during the renovation? A: Night shift enters via the side door on the loading bay, not the main entrance — it's locked after 19:00. Sign the night log inside the door. Lights are on a motion timer. Enter using the keypad code below.

turnstile pass: bdg-FVNQRS-72965873

ScanBridge is the middleware that connects handheld barcode scanners in our partner warehouses to the Cratefox inventory system. When a customer reports scans not appearing, first confirm their scanner firmware is on a supported version, then check that their site's ScanBridge agent is registered and signed in correctly. Unsigned agents are quarantined automatically, which is the most common cause of "silent" scan failures. To re-register a quarantined agent during a support call, you'll need the current agent signing key:

release key, fajef-kajeg: bky19_LdLu6Ne6FLi8he2c24d

## Changelog — 2.4.1

- Fixed stale-cache bug where Fernbrook's edge nodes served expired catalog entries after failover.
- Root cause: TTL clock skew between regions; postmortem doc is linked in the team wiki for new joiners.
- Added skew-tolerant expiry check and failover drill to onboarding.
- Questions about the postmortem or the fix should go to the author below.

named custodian: Brivan Eliath Quenox Frador

Ticket: Staging env misconfigured for Siftgate bloom filter

The bloom layer in front of the Pellet KV store is rejecting all lookups in staging because the env file was copied from the dev template without credentials. False-positive tuning values are fine; only the auth line is missing. To unblock the weekly demo, the Pellet admission secret must be set on the following line.

env line for yaguf-fajop: LEDGER_TOKEN13=fb08984397349